在ThinkPad T420上安装Archlinux
- cnkilior
- 论坛版主
- 帖子: 4984
- 注册时间: 2007-08-05 17:40
Re: 在ThinkPad T420上安装Archlinux
系统自带了一个hdaps模块,要把这个删掉。
还有我没有在源码找到这个log,[ 668.458475] hdaps: supported laptop not found!
还有我没有在源码找到这个log,[ 668.458475] hdaps: supported laptop not found!
- phoenixlzx
- 帖子: 2245
- 注册时间: 2009-07-29 20:11
- 系统: Arch Linux
- 来自: Gensokyo
- 联系:
Re: 在ThinkPad T420上安装Archlinux
代码: 全选
sudo rm /lib/modules/2.6.39-ARCH/kernel/drivers/platform/x86/hdaps.ko.gz
代码: 全选
$ HDAPS=true make
make -C /lib/modules/2.6.39-ARCH/build M=/home/phoenix/ThinkPad/tp_smapi-0.40 O=/lib/modules/2.6.39-ARCH/build modules
make[1]: 进入目录“/usr/src/linux-2.6.39-ARCH”
CC [M] /home/phoenix/ThinkPad/tp_smapi-0.40/thinkpad_ec.o
/home/phoenix/ThinkPad/tp_smapi-0.40/thinkpad_ec.c: 在函数‘check_dmi_for_ec’中:
/home/phoenix/ThinkPad/tp_smapi-0.40/thinkpad_ec.c:473:1: 警告:栈帧有 3104 字节,超过了 2048 字节 [-Wframe-larger-than=]
CC [M] /home/phoenix/ThinkPad/tp_smapi-0.40/tp_smapi.o
Building modules, stage 2.
MODPOST 2 modules
CC /home/phoenix/ThinkPad/tp_smapi-0.40/thinkpad_ec.mod.o
LD [M] /home/phoenix/ThinkPad/tp_smapi-0.40/thinkpad_ec.ko
CC /home/phoenix/ThinkPad/tp_smapi-0.40/tp_smapi.mod.o
LD [M] /home/phoenix/ThinkPad/tp_smapi-0.40/tp_smapi.ko
make[1]: 离开目录“/usr/src/linux-2.6.39-ARCH”
$ sudo make install
make -C /lib/modules/2.6.39-ARCH/build M=/home/phoenix/ThinkPad/tp_smapi-0.40 O=/lib/modules/2.6.39-ARCH/build modules
make[1]: 进入目录“/usr/src/linux-2.6.39-ARCH”
Building modules, stage 2.
MODPOST 2 modules
make[1]: 离开目录“/usr/src/linux-2.6.39-ARCH”
rm -f /lib/modules/2.6.39-ARCH/kernel/drivers/misc/{thinkpad_ec,tp_smapi,tp_base}.ko
rm -f /lib/modules/2.6.39-ARCH/kernel/drivers/firmware/{thinkpad_ec,tp_smapi,tp_base}.ko
rm -f /lib/modules/2.6.39-ARCH/kernel/extra/{thinkpad_ec,tp_smapi,tp_base}.ko
make -C /lib/modules/2.6.39-ARCH/build M=/home/phoenix/ThinkPad/tp_smapi-0.40 modules_install
make[1]: 进入目录“/usr/src/linux-2.6.39-ARCH”
INSTALL /home/phoenix/ThinkPad/tp_smapi-0.40/thinkpad_ec.ko
INSTALL /home/phoenix/ThinkPad/tp_smapi-0.40/tp_smapi.ko
DEPMOD 2.6.39-ARCH
make[1]: 离开目录“/usr/src/linux-2.6.39-ARCH”
depmod -a
FATAL: Module hdaps not found.
代码: 全选
我真小白了.....
-
- 帖子: 22323
- 注册时间: 2010-07-19 21:41
- 系统: OS X
-
- 帖子: 22323
- 注册时间: 2010-07-19 21:41
- 系统: OS X
Re: 在ThinkPad T420上安装Archlinux
我放弃了……
错误类似:
kernel: thinkpad_ec: thinkpad_ec read row: failed requesting row: (0x11:0x00)->0xfffffff0
直接 -hdaps,不折腾了……
错误类似:
kernel: thinkpad_ec: thinkpad_ec read row: failed requesting row: (0x11:0x00)->0xfffffff0
直接 -hdaps,不折腾了……
躺平
- phoenixlzx
- 帖子: 2245
- 注册时间: 2009-07-29 20:11
- 系统: Arch Linux
- 来自: Gensokyo
- 联系:
Re: 在ThinkPad T420上安装Archlinux
代码: 全选
FATAL:device not found
- cnkilior
- 论坛版主
- 帖子: 4984
- 注册时间: 2007-08-05 17:40
Re: 在ThinkPad T420上安装Archlinux
aur 里面有这个包,把pkgbuild下载下来,改改,再加个patch就好了。
- phoenixlzx
- 帖子: 2245
- 注册时间: 2009-07-29 20:11
- 系统: Arch Linux
- 来自: Gensokyo
- 联系:
Re: 在ThinkPad T420上安装Archlinux

我崩溃了.....
最近T420经常“死机”,硬盘没有任何响应,害我强制关机....
- phoenixlzx
- 帖子: 2245
- 注册时间: 2009-07-29 20:11
- 系统: Arch Linux
- 来自: Gensokyo
- 联系:
Re: 在ThinkPad T420上安装Archlinux
SOLVED!
只要简单安装tp_smapi即可,不需要任何的XXX东西~~

只要简单安装tp_smapi即可,不需要任何的XXX东西~~



-
- 帖子: 4
- 注册时间: 2010-01-26 21:55
Re: 在ThinkPad T420上安装Archlinux
刚刚准备入手T420S,非常感谢!
- Dim
- 帖子: 640
- 注册时间: 2009-04-06 15:03
- Dim
- 帖子: 640
- 注册时间: 2009-04-06 15:03
Re: 在ThinkPad T420上安装Archlinux
请问能细说乍么操作吗?我安了bumblebee了
安装bumblebee,命令:
代码:
yaourt bumblebee
安装后把nvidia添加到modules,bumblebee添加到daemons中。(乍么加入,)
系统启动时默认使用Intel集成显卡,需要视频加速时用下面的命令启用NVIDIA 显卡,现在已经支持CUDA4.0
安装bumblebee,命令:
代码:
yaourt bumblebee
安装后把nvidia添加到modules,bumblebee添加到daemons中。(乍么加入,)
系统启动时默认使用Intel集成显卡,需要视频加速时用下面的命令启用NVIDIA 显卡,现在已经支持CUDA4.0
好好学习,天天向上!
-
- 帖子: 167
- 注册时间: 2008-03-06 17:45
Re: 在ThinkPad T420上安装Archlinux
mark一下
呵呵,希望有用啊。
呵呵,希望有用啊。
- youqika
- 帖子: 720
- 注册时间: 2008-09-25 20:56
-
- 帖子: 25
- 注册时间: 2010-11-26 12:29
Re: 在ThinkPad T420上安装Archlinux
mark!我也用的是t420。最近正要转arch。有问题的话,向前辈求助了。
-
- 帖子: 9
- 注册时间: 2011-04-25 16:09
Re: 在ThinkPad T420上安装Archlinux
很好,支持下,还没有都试,但看的出来很不错。